2016-04-26 3 views
1

Мне нужен JQL-фильтр, который соответствует тому, что находится в отставании, и имеет тот же порядок, что и для отставания.JQL-фильтр, соответствующий отставанию, включая порядок

Мой владелец продукта и я заказали все отставание, и мне нужен мой фильтр, чтобы это отразить.

Моя текущая попытка имеет примерно пять с половиной раза больше предметов, как отставание ... 900 против 159 фактических элементов в отставании

project="Project Name" AND issuetype != Epic AND (Sprint is EMPTY OR Sprint not in (openSprints(), futureSprints())) and status != Closed Order by RANK 

заказ не правильно либо.

Как фильтровать элементы в соответствии с тем, что имеет отставание, и показать тот же порядок?

+0

Я обнаружил, что следующее прекрасно работает: project = "Project Name" AND issueetype not in (epic, subTaskIssueTypes()) AND (Sprint - ПУСТОЙ ИЛИ Спринт не в (openSprints(), futureSprints())) И статус не in (Закрыто, Принято, Поставлено) ORDER BY RANK ASC –

ответ

1

Если вы проверите конфигурацию своей доски, у нее будет несколько настроек фильтра, которые укажут, какие проблемы должны отображаться на вашей плате и в случае отставания. Доступна документация here. Экран выглядит следующим образом:

enter image description here

С содержимым Сохраненный фильтр и Фильтр запроса поля вы должны быть в состоянии построить запрос JQL, который соответствует вашему накопившихся. Поле В рейтинге указано, как задаются вопросы, но обычно это делается их . Ранг, который вы уже используете в своем JQL. Вы можете добавить ASC или DESC чтобы изменить направление заказа, т.е. ORDER BY RANK DESC.

Эти правила определяют, какие вопросы будут видны в отставании для вашей платы:

Вопрос будет виден в Отставание только если:

  • вопрос не является Подзадача,
  • вопрос соответствует сохраненному фильтр на плате (см Настройка фильтров),
  • карты состояния этого вопроса в один из столбцов платы (но не «Done» столбцов), и
  • есть по крайней мере статус, отображаемый в правой колонке. Например. Если у вас есть столбцы «Делать», «Выполнять» и «Готово», убедитесь, что у вас есть статус, отображаемый как «Прогресс», по крайней мере. Если вы сопоставляете все статусы с первым столбцом (To Do), вы не сможете увидеть какие-либо проблемы в Backlog.

Это взято из этой documentation page.

+0

Я нашел решение (см. выше), но для отображаемого отставания перед вами, на какой «сохраненный фильтр» или «запрос фильтра» вы смотрите? Я не вижу, где можно просмотреть компоненты запроса backlog. Моя единственная отправная точка - «очистить все фильтры» в верхней части списка отставаний. У меня может быть более 2000 вопросов, но у моего отставания всего 157 таких, без фильтров на –

+0

@RobertAchmann, хорошо, что вы уже нашли правильный JQL.Я добавил больше подробностей к моему ответу, который, надеюсь, объясняет, почему ваш JQL выполняет свою работу. – GlennV